"O Rising Sun, send your healing rays of love into our lives. I never cease to be amazed at what a night's rest can do for a troubled heart. After a day disrupted by a misunderstanding with a family member, a disagreement with a friend, or bad news at work, all can look new and full of hope in the bright pinks and deep blues of the Advent morning sky. May we open our eyes to the gift of each new day, to look with awe and wonder at the sunrise and allow God's healing to touch our lives and the lives of all we love."

- Sr. Linda Herndon, OSB
